I always wanted to breastfeed until 12 months too but I just weaned at 7.5 months. My baby also refused bottles since he was exclusively nursed but we had luck with a straw cup (first years). He picked it up in a couple of days. We chose not to teach bottle skills since he would’ve needed to transition to straw / open cup at 12 months anyways. Initially we struggled because he didn’t like the formula taste, but it doesn’t sound like that’s the issue here. Do you have a hypothesis of why she won’t take milk in the straw cup?

Mostly helps with prevention. For treatment, I do ice, ibuprofen, breast gymnastics, and breast lifts. I also look for milk blebs. Since writing the original post, I discovered that one area that keeps getting clogged is usually due to milk blebs on a specific nipple pore.
